XMPP登录注册1
1. 环境准备:openfire + mysql 5.1.6 + Xcode5 + XMPP.Framework (至于环境的配置, 请自己百度, 推荐: http://www.cnblogs.com/xiaodao/archive/2013/04/05/3000554.html)
2. cocoapods
1 platform :ios, '7.0' 2 pod "XMPPFramework", "~>3.6.4"
3.工程: ARC + COREDATA + XIB(Storyboard)
4.直奔重点: XMPP工具单例
1. 首先, 创建一个Infromation.h 文件 用来存放我们需要的一些基本信息,比如host之类的。 然后把这个头文件导入pch文件中 注意我的Domains 后边多一个@
1 #ifndef ADXMPP_BE_Information_h 2 #define ADXMPP_BE_Information_h 3 4 #define SERVER @"127.0.0.1" 5 #define DOMAINS @"@127.0.0.1" 6 7 #endif
2. 创建ADXMPPConn 类、 开始编辑我们的XMPP连接、 登录、 注册核心代码
